When Scott was brought on to helm ALIEN he had the idea of making Ash a Martian... The producers took him aside and laid down what kind of universe ALIEN was set in: it was a universe where mankind was alone... nothing at all like what had been envisioned in Star Trek or Star Wars. The encounter with the alien would have marked the first time humanity had encountered a substantial life form other than their own. Giler and Hill stuck to this when filming ALIENS and ALIEN 3. So when Cameron took on ALIENS he was aware of this.

In some of the supplemental material on the Quadrilogy Cameron had stated that people would be more open about sexuality by the time of ALIEN and ALIENS, and would undergo procedures to change their sex with far greater acceptance than present day society. One thing that he pointed out was that on the Crew profiles that were on-screen behind Ripley during her inquest was the term "Neutral" for Gender. He also made reference to the rather androgens looking woman at the inquest.

So it's possible that the Bebops are a society that are known for frequent gender changing... This could make it difficult to get a positive ID on a BeBop insurgent/warrior if they tended to change gender frequently. ...effectively bringing guerilla warfare to a new level. ...Of course Cameron's comments may shed some light on what an Arcturian is, as well. Especially if, according to the film's writer/director and producers, there were no other forms of intelligent life in the universe as of the time frame of ALIENS.

Now gender swapping aside. Bebops could also be pirates, or some form of colonial insurgents that jump from colony to colony, or planet to planet - "Bee Bopping." Part of what the Marines did was police actions to help maintain order in human colonized space. So to that end opposing forces were likely those involved in local uprisings or coos, piracy, border disputes, illegal trafficking, and the like. And throw in galactic exterminators for dealing with infestations of local fauna that didn't mesh well with human colonization.

Quote:
and were wholly unprepared for a species like the xenomorphs who exhibited uncommon intelligence


Again this ties in with the Vietnam allegory- a technologically inferior force (the Vietcong) who fought with such tenacity that the lack of technology was not a handicap.

In the case of Aliens- the USCM were arrogant in believing their small but armed to the teeth group could handle anything. They were totally unprepared for the overwhelming number, and guerilla tactics of the Xenos.
